C/C++
文章平均质量分 75
dream_y06
这个作者很懒,什么都没留下…
展开
-
《The C Programming Language》学习笔记——位运算
C语言提供了6个用于位操作的运算符,这些运算符只能作用于整数分量,即只能作用于有符号和无符号的char、short、int和long类型。& —— 屏蔽某些位 | —— 打开某些位^ —— 在两个运算分量的对应位不相同时置该位为1,否则,置该位为0。>> —— 将左运算分量右移由右运算分量所指定的位数~ —— 求整数的反码Tips:1. 我们常用移位取反等操作的组合求原创 2006-08-12 00:42:00 · 973 阅读 · 0 评论 -
VC++学习笔记——Windows程序内部运行原理
◆总体结构进行Windows程序设计,实际时在进行一种面向对象的程序设计(OOP)。最典型的对象就是窗口。对象的代码是窗口过程;数据是窗口过程保存的信息,以及每个窗口系统中那个窗口类保存的信息。OS调用应用程序(系统调用),是Windows面向对象体系结构的基础。◆三大难点1.系统调用,OS通过窗口过程来给窗口发送消息。2.进队和不进队消息,进队的消息被发送给消息队列,不今对的消息则发送给窗口原创 2006-08-22 00:56:00 · 1170 阅读 · 0 评论 -
《The C Programming Language》学习笔记——指针与数组1
◆ 概念:指针是一种用于存放另一个变量的地址的变量。ANSI C中用类型void *作为通用指针类型。◆ 指针的类型 每一个指针对象有确定的数据类型,一个指针只能指向一个特定类型的对象。 除 void* ,类型不一致要进行强制类型转换。 如:int *p; int x; p = &x; *p =原创 2006-08-22 18:56:00 · 782 阅读 · 1 评论